TIRANA, June 1 – Albania has introduced a temporary visa-free regime for Russian nationals from June 1 to October 31. The Albanian ambassador to Moscow, Sokol Gjoka, was quoted by ITAR-TASS saying, “We remove the visa regime for the summer to enable Russian nationals to freely travel in Albania. Not only tourists, but also all other categories of citizens, including businessmen and participants in international and cultural events, can take advantage of the visa-free regime,” said Gjoka.
Albania is the third country to lift visas for Russian citizens. Gjoka does not rule out that in 2012 Russians will be able to visit Albania without visas again.
